Summary

Covering foam composition and uses, this book presents the basics of foaming different polymeric materials. Topics include siloxane, polyimide, polyester, polyisocyanurate, and polyurethane foams. There are also individual chapters on solid-state microcellular foams and extruded microcellular foams, a comprehensive chapter on bubble morphology characterization and its relation to foam properties, as well as a broad chapter on the modeling of intumescent fire-retardant polymers. There are also two theoretical chapters on aspects of foam extrusion and the dynamics of bubble growth.
